Unifor ACL represents the Bell Aliant unionized workers in the four Atlantic provinces: Prince Edward Island – Unifor Local 401, Newfoundland and Labrador - Unifor Local 410, New Brunswick – Unifor Local 506, [and] Nova Scotia – Unifor Local 2289.

OBS

The purpose of the Unifor ACL is: to jointly bargain and administer all aspects of the common collective agreement between UACL Locals 401, 410, 506 and 2289 and their employer; to jointly establish, administer and manage all designated UACL funds; to encourage membership through the member Locals and through the broader labour movement; to promote cooperation in collective bargaining among the member Locals; to promote job security and enhance the terms and conditions of employment for all members of the UACL; to provide appropriate representation for the membership of each of the member Locals; to regulate relations between individual members and their employer; to promote solidarity within the labour movement; [and to] work in concert with Unifor National, the CLC [Canadian Labour Congress] and Federations of Labour to support political action campaigns.
